Subject: Re: [PATCH v2 2/2] PCI: qcom: Add sc8180x compatible
Date: Mon, 23 Aug 2021 12:47:55 -0500 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<YSPfSxwMpmGkTxEf@robh.at.kernel.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20210823154958.305677-2-bjorn.andersson@linaro.org>
On Mon, 23 Aug 2021 08:49:58 -0700, Bjorn Andersson wrote:
> The SC8180x platform comes with 4 PCIe controllers, typically used for
> things such as NVME storage or connecting a SDX55 5G modem. Add a
> compatible for this, that just reuses the 1.9.0 ops.
